- The distance between Aepto.San Luis, Colombia and Kengtung, Myanmar is approximately 17,538 km or 10,898 mi.
- To reach Aepto.San Luis in this distance one would set out from Kengtung bearing 352.7°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Aepto.San Luis bearing 186.8° or S .
- Aepto.San Luis has a subtropical highland climate with no dry season (Cfb) whereas Kengtung has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Aepto.San Luis is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Kengtung is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 12.5 °C (22.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) less in Aepto.San Luis.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 344 mm (13.5 in) less which is equivalent to 344 l/m² (8.44 US gal/ft²) or 3,440,000 l/ha (367,759 US gal/ac) less. About 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.5° higher in Aepto.San Luis than in Kengtung.
